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 working arrangements no further relates to many people. With all the increase of dual-income homes and non-traditional work hours, the demand for 24-hour daycare solutions happ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ities provide moms and dads the flexibleness they should stabilize work and family obligations,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for kids night and day.

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

One of many crucial benefits of 24-hour daycare could be the freedom it gives working parents. Many moms and dads work shifts that extend be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, rendering it difficult to get childcare that suits their particular rout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this issue by giving treatment during evenings, vacations, and also in a single day. This permits moms and dads to focus without fretting about finding you to definitely watch their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the satisfaction it provides to parents. Knowing that their children are now being taken care of by trained experts in a safe and protected environment can relieve the tension and shame very often is sold with leaving children in daycare. Parents can consider their work realizing that their children come in great hands, which could induce increased output and work p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ers can provide a feeling of community and assistance for people. Moms and dads who work non-traditional hours often find it difficult to discover childcare options that meet their demands, causing emotions of isolation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a sense of that belong and camaraderie among parents dealing with comparable difficulties, creating a support community that can help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er advantages, additionally they come with their collection of difficulties. One of the biggest difficulties is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ers that happy to work non-traditional hours may be tough, ultimately causing large return prices and prospective staffing shortages. This may affect the quality of care offered to kiddies and produce instability for families dep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the price. Providing attention around the clock calls for additional staffing and resources, that may drive within the cost of services. This is a barrier for low-income households which may possibly not be able to afford 24-hour daycare, leaving them with limited cho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can make sure the protection and well-being of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and supervision are necessary. State and local governments put requirements for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including the ones that run round the clock. These standards cover a wide range of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ety requirements, and staff training and qualifications.

Along with government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ities elect to look for certification from national businesses such as the nationwide Association when it comes to Education of small children (NAEYC) or the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to top-notch attention and can help moms and dads feel confident in their choice of childcare supplier.
